The US Attorney's Office Observes National Crime Victims' Rights Week
U.S. Attorney Dena J. King and the U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Western District of North Carolina join the Justice Department, law enforcement agencies, service providers, allied professionals and communities nationwide to commemorate National Crime Victims’ Rights Week (NCVRW) from April 21-27, 2024.

The US military is embedding its officers in corporate America
The government should do more business with McKinsey & Co. — one of the world’s largest consulting firms — says a Pentagon presentation: “Leverage [the] consulting firm’s expertise and objectivity – outsourcing is a positive action.” While this might sound like a talking point from lobbyists, it actually came from an active-duty naval commander who spent almost a full year working at McKinsey & Co. with you, the taxpayer, footing the bill.
